The Assistant Director, Fast Track MBA Programs is responsible for planning, delivery, and overall administration of the blended learning Fast Track MBA program. Specifically responsible for the daily administration of operations and for contributing to a high quality student experience which is achieved by working closely with the Senior Associate Director, Fast Track MBA, Director of Graduate Programs, Fast Track Faculty Director, Administrative Coordinator, students, clients, administration, distance learning partner, and faculty to deliver quality MBA experiences and determine opportunities for improvement; and working closely with the Senior Associate Director, Fast Track MBA, Director of Graduate Programs, and Fast Track Faculty Director in planning, organizing, and conducting the activities connected with delivering all aspects of blended learning MBA program.

Key Responsibilities:
Program Administration and Development:
Collaborates with the Senior Associate Director, Fast Track MBA, Fast Track Faculty Director, Blended Learning, and Director of Graduate Programs in strategic planning and implementation, program development, graduate school policy formulation and enforcement, course planning, and curriculum development.
Responsible for all program management aspects associated with the Fast Track program.
Manages and administers the Fast Track MBA program, with an understanding of the objectives, criteria, and format established by the Graduate School. This includes meeting with the Senior Associate Director, Fast Track MBA, Director of Graduate Programs, Fast Track Faculty Director, faculty, corporate clients, and distance learning providers on a regular basis, setting and assessing program goals, and making ongoing changes and adjustments.
Participates in developing and recommending policies, plans, and procedures that positively affect program administration, delivery, and effectiveness. Reports and makes recommendations on issues affecting the graduate programs, such as policies, class size, scheduling, teaching assignments, and curriculum matters.
Creates and maintains the academic program calendar for cohorts managed.
Serves as primary liaison with the distance learning partner on the design, creation and maintenance of digital content. Manages the programs' Blackboard sites and serves as primary contact with GSBL and ITSD for Blackboard issues and all other issues associated with electronic content and additionally helps orient new faculty to the blended learning format and technology.
Serves as primary liaison with Babson Executive Conference Center (BECC) to plan meeting rooms and logistics and serves as primary contact with BECC Sales and Event Planning staff to secure classrooms and for all issues associated with classroom space.
Manages student compliance with College and Graduate School policies and procedures and their understanding thereof.
Assists San Francisco Assistant Director with corresponding program delivery tasks including program schedule creation, course set-up, and course material ordering.
Assists with implementation of co-curricular program, orientations, and specialty courses.
Manages and maintains the curriculum materials and documents such as the schedules, cases, course materials, and online content critical to program integrity and success. Contributes to the preparation of various publications including the Graduate Handbook, admit packet, and deposit materials for incoming students.
Serves on College-wide and Graduate School Committees as assigned.

Student Services and Advising:
Manages academic advising for remote student population.
Advises students on academic, financial, and personal matters, referring students to appropriate personnel and campus departments as necessary. Monitors the academic progress, academic deficiencies, and retention of students. Counsels prospective and current Fast Track MBA students
